Kyiv court extends custodial term of Russians Yerofeyev and Alexandrov by another two months
The Holosiyivsky District Court of Kyiv has extended the custodial term of Russian citizens Yevgeny Yerofeyev and Alexander Alexandrov by another 60 days until November 21.
Such a decision was announced by Judge Mykola Didyk, who chaired the court's preparatory session on Tuesday, an Interfax correspondent has reported.
Alexandrov and Yerofeyev were detained by the Ukrainian intelligence service on May 16, 2015, in the military operation zone in the area of the town of Schastia in the Luhansk region. One of them was wounded in the hand, the other one in the leg.
Ukraine said Yerofeyev and Alexandrov were Russian soldiers.
A court in Kyiv ruled on the arrest of the two Russians.
